A vibrant basil sauce made from fresh basil, pine nuts, garlic, parmesan, and olive oil. Made in minutes, this traditional Italian pesto is better than store-bought and freezes well.

Ingredients
serves 10- 2 cups packed fresh basil leaves (about 2 large bunches)
- 1/3 cup pine nuts
- 1/2 cup freshly grated parmesan cheese
- 2 cloves garlic
- 1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 1/2 cup olive oil
